Page 3 sur 3
Re: non reconnaissance de windows par le grub linux
Posté : mar. 22 juil. 2025 23:47
par Fuster13012
Dernier message de la page précédente :
bonsoir
pour Junga :
donne
Code : Tout sélectionner
[sudo] Mot de passe de xxx:
Searching for GRUB installation directory ... found: /boot/grub
Searching for default file ... found: /boot/grub/default
Testing for an existing GRUB menu.lst file ... found: /boot/grub/menu.lst
Searching for splash image ... none found, skipping ...
Found kernel: /boot/vmlinuz-6.1.0-37-amd64
Found kernel: /boot/vmlinuz-6.1.0-12-amd64
Updating /boot/grub/menu.lst ... done
Pour Jennatux:
Code : Tout sélectionner
lsblk -fe7 | cat
NAME FSTYPE FSVER LABEL UUID FSAVAIL FSUSE% MOUNTPOINTS
sda
├─sda1 swap 1 29595e4d-372b-4f86-9651-24078badcce7 [SWAP]
└─sda2 ext4 1.0 d0b57ee5-1409-4526-b5d1-f09afe7c78f0 371,8G 12% /
sdb
├─sdb1 ntfs Récupération 84F2B9CEF2B9C528
├─sdb2 vfat FAT32 2EBC-1F35
├─sdb3
├─sdb4 ntfs OS Terra 0E6021D96021C7F3
└─sdb5 ntfs Données 367A53E27A539D85
sdc
├─sdc1
├─sdc2 ntfs C67C7F407C7F29F7
├─sdc3 ntfs 98F0371BF036FF56
└─sdc4 ntfs 108117FD108117FD
sdd
sde
sdf
sdg
sr0
J'ai en effet 3 disques : 1ssd avec l'OS windows sdc (mais malheureusement le windows boot manager sur le 2em disque HDD sdb dont 2 partitions appelées Terra et données) et 1SSD avec Linux sda.
mon bios est UEFI
Re: non reconnaissance de windows par le grub linux
Posté : mer. 23 juil. 2025 00:04
par Jennatux
Je ne vois pas le point de montage boot/efi sur sdb2
donne le retour de
Code : Tout sélectionner
[[ -d /sys/firmware/efi ]] && echo "Session EFI" || echo "Session non-EFI"
Re: non reconnaissance de windows par le grub linux
Posté : jeu. 24 juil. 2025 16:38
par Fuster13012
bonjour Jennatux
J'ai eu un doute quand vous m'aviez posé la question si j'étais en UEFI. Je sais que oui pour windows et le PC mais j'avais un doute sur Linux mint, or 2 commandes m'ont montré que non:
-la tienne :
Code : Tout sélectionner
[[ -d /sys/firmware/efi ]] && echo "Session EFI" || echo "Session non-EFI"
Session non-EFI
-
Code : Tout sélectionner
~$ sudo efibootmgr
EFI variables are not supported on this system.
Donc Linux est en Legacy c'est pourquoi je n'arrive jamais à harmoniser les 2 OS. quand je bidouille le bios, ça coince toujours quelque part.Il me semble comprendre en lisant les sites qu'il faut (ou du moins qu'il vaut mieux) avoir les 2 OS sur le même mode. J'attends votre confirmation. Si c'est le cas dois-je réinstaller Linuxmint et formater le disque en Fat 32 avant (et pas en ext4 si j'ai bien compris) et je pense qu'au cours de l'installation il doit me proposer UFI ou bien puis-je transformer mon Legacy en UFI sans tout réinstaller et surtout en gardant mes données et installations? cela me ferait gagner du temps. Si c'est bien ça j'ai lu aussi de désactiver le sécure boot mais avec w11 je crois que ce n'est pas possible ainsi que CSM (qui rend compatible les deux systèmes).
j'attends vos réponses avec impatience pour essayer de faire progresser ma recherche.
cordialement
Re: non reconnaissance de windows par le grub linux
Posté : jeu. 24 juil. 2025 21:38
par Jennatux
Oui, il faut que les deux os soient installés sur le même mode
il faut que la table de partition soient en GPT , il ya grand chance que le disque ou tu as installé Linux soit en msdos
Vérifier avec la commande
ou gparted → Affichage → Informations sur le périphérique, et si pas en GPT, toujours sur Gparted →Périphérique → Créer une table de partitions et choisir GPT
À l'installation de LM, en général la partition EFI du disque Windows sera reconnu comme telle, sinon la déclarer comme partition EFI en lui mettant le point de montage /boot/efi
(surtout ne pas choisir "Formater cette partition")
Re: non reconnaissance de windows par le grub linux
Posté : jeu. 24 juil. 2025 23:43
par Fuster13012
bonsoir. voici la réponse à ta commande:
Code : Tout sélectionner
sudo fdisk -l
Disk /dev/sda: 465,76 GiB, 500107862016 bytes, 976773168 sectors
Disk model: Samsung SSD 870
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: dos
Disk identifier: 0x13415f6f
Device Boot Start End Sectors Size Id Type
/dev/sda1 3906 16800781 16796876 8G 83 Linux
/dev/sda2 16801792 976773119 959971328 457,8G 83 Linux
Disk /dev/sdb: 1,82 TiB, 2000398934016 bytes, 3907029168 sectors
Disk model: ST2000DM001-1ER1
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
Disklabel type: gpt
Disk identifier: 8C87705B-E19C-4B62-B5D7-9B58CCC344C5
Device Start End Sectors Size Type
/dev/sdb1 2048 923647 921600 450M Windows recovery environment
/dev/sdb2 923648 1126399 202752 99M EFI System
/dev/sdb3 1126400 1159167 32768 16M Microsoft reserved
/dev/sdb4 1159168 323026943 321867776 153,5G Microsoft basic data
/dev/sdb5 323026944 3907026943 3584000000 1,7T Microsoft basic data
Disk /dev/sdc: 238,47 GiB, 256060514304 bytes, 500118192 sectors
Disk model: Samsung SSD 850
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: 88D54967-4069-4DC9-B088-ABC4DCBF6A93
Device Start End Sectors Size Type
/dev/sdc1 2048 34815 32768 16M Microsoft reserved
/dev/sdc2 34816 458784439 458749624 218,7G Microsoft basic data
/dev/sdc3 458784768 460169215 1384448 676M Windows recovery environment
/dev/sdc4 460171264 500115455 39944192 19G Microsoft basic data
donne:
Par contre je ne comprends pas bien la dernière partie de ton message. si je clique sur "créer une table de partition" il me réponds que j'ai 2 partitions actives en cours et qu'il est impossible de créer une table de partition lorsque les partitions sont actives. Faut il que j'utilise gparted depuis un live usb? en créant des partitions GPT je suppose que je reformate tout ? ou bien ça peut se transformer sans réintallation? autre question si je crée un table de partition gpt sur quelle partition, les deux, sda1,sda2 ?
"sinon la déclarer comme partition EFI en lui mettant le point de montage /boot/efi " comment ça se fait ?
merci pour toutes ces précisions.
Re: non reconnaissance de windows par le grub linux
Posté : ven. 25 juil. 2025 00:25
par Jennatux
Tu ne peux créer de table de partition que si le disque ne contient pas de partition, c'est donc dans le cas où tu envisages de réinstaller LM.
Donc si c'est le cas, il faut supprimer les partitions et créer une table de partitions, bien sûr prendre soins de sauvegarder les données persos.
(Pour éviter de sauvegarder et réincorporer après l'installation, en général, on fait une partition pour le système de 40 à 50 Go, puis une autre pour les données où l'on met le point de montage /home.)
Re: non reconnaissance de windows par le grub linux
Posté : ven. 25 juil. 2025 08:02
par Fuster13012
Merci beaucoup Jennatux,je comprends mieux. Je ne vais pas le faire tout de suite, comme ça marche pour l'instant en faisant f8 au démarrage pour choisir de booter sous Windows, sinon ça part sur Linux mais je sais quoi faire. dernières questions avant de mettre en résolu, si je fais la réinstallation dois-je mettre dans le bios:
-désactiver boot sécure comme je l'ai souvent lu mais je crois que windonws 11 en a besoin ?
-désactiver le démarrage rapide quick boot ou fast boot?
-TPM device activé (TM 2) c'est aussi important pour W 11 dans pour mon bios advanced/ PCH-FW configuration
-CSM désactivé (compatibilité UFI/Hérité ou Legacy) actuellement activé sinon je ne vois plus un OS
cordialement
Re: non reconnaissance de windows par le grub linux
Posté : ven. 25 juil. 2025 09:23
par Jennatux
Désactiver secure-boot, suffit
Bonne journée
Re: non reconnaissance de windows par le grub linux
Posté : sam. 26 juil. 2025 09:22
par Fuster13012
merci beaucoup à ceux qui m'ont répondu. Je vais souffler un peu et m'occuper d'autres problèmes sous Linux . Je verrai plus tard pour réinstaller Linux en UFI.
cordialement